Campaign Cycle Oversight
Election cycle management is a demanding process that encompasses numerous stages, from voter enrollment to the final declaration of results. A well-structured election cycle ensures fairness and fosters public trust in the democratic process.
Effective management begins with enrolling eligible voters, followed by candidate selection. Throughout the campaign period, various initiatives are undertaken more info to engage voters and convey campaign agendas.
Debates provide opportunities for candidates to express their goals and influence public opinion. Ultimately, election day involves the recording of votes and a subsequent tabulation process to determine the winner.
Post-election activities focus on confirming the results and addressing any disputes that may arise. Continuous evaluation of the election cycle helps identify areas for enhancement to ensure future elections are efficient.
